SB SAT @ AMSAT $ANS-318.01 AMSAT SCI-FI CHANNEL SEGMENT UPDATE (Special ANS Bulletin) HR AMSAT NEWS SERVICE BULLETIN 318.01 FROM AMSAT HQ SILVER SPRING, MD NOVEMBER 14, 1995 TO ALL RADIO AMATEURS BT BID: $ANS-318.01 AMSAT STILL SET FOR TV DEBUT NOVEMBER 17th AMSAT and Amateur Radio are still slated to be part of the cable television Sci-Fi Channel's "Inside Space" program set to air the weekend of November 17th. Plans call for airings on Friday evening, November 17th at 9 PM Eastern time in the USA and then again at 1 AM Eastern (four hours later) on Saturday morning. An additional airing of the program is also set for 11 AM (Eastern) on the following Sunday, November 19th. One minor change has occurred since the first announcement of AMSAT's inclusion in the program. Initial reports indicated the show was set to include multiple scenes from the AMSAT Phase 3-D satellite lab in Orlando, as well as perhaps ARRL Field Day and other Amateur Radio scenes, according to AMSAT-NA's Executive Vice President Keith Baker, KB1SF. "However, the latest word we have from the producers is that AMSAT's piece of the program will most likely now be split into two segments." Baker said. He indicated the first segment is still slated to air this weekend (November 17) and will probably include a broad overview of AMSAT's activities over the years, along with scenes and discussion of other Amateur Radio related activities. Keith went on to note that another segment of the program (featuring more of Phase 3-D) will most likely be aired closer to P3-D's launch date later next year.
